Ever buy your dream TV, bring it home, set it up in your living room, and just when you’re ready to kick-back into LCD-heaven, you find out it doesn’t work? If you have, then here’s how to say it in Filipino – the simplest way possible. Join Mickey and Cris as they explore the world of brokenness and um, fixed-ness.
A: Kuya, pwede ipapalit?
B: Bakit?
A: Sira siya eh.
B: Hmm… ayos siya. Hindi lang naka-plug
A: Kuya, can we have this exchanged?
B: Why?
A: It’s broken.
B: Hmm, it’s working fine. It just wasn’t plugged.
